Block

#12,037,354
Block Number
12,037,354 @ 04/25/2022, 13:50:30
Status
Finalized
ID
0x00b7aceae52d08c756a453c64a236568d6265389ccaa8c94a3e6cacfdf9a1d40
Transactions
Gas Used
385814/17096517 (2.26% Used)
Total Score
1,166,969,312 (+101)
Rewards
1.88 VTHO